Broadway Tax Credit Program Nears Depletion, Raising Concerns for Future Productions
by A.A. Cristi - Jul 17, 2025


A New York State tax credit program that has supported Broadway and Off-Broadway productions since the pandemic is nearing its funding limit, far ahead of its intended expiration in 2027.
